We propose a new integrable coupled dispersionless equation with self-consistent sources (CDESCS). We obtain the Lax pair and the equivalent generalized Heisenberg ferromagnet equation (GHFE), demonstrating its integrability. Specifically, we explore the geometry of these equations. Last, we consider the relation between the motion of curves/surfaces and the CDESCS and the GHFE.

AbstractA self-consistent study of the formation of planetary bodies beyond the orbit of Saturn and the evolution of Kuiper disks is carried out by means of an N-body code where accretion and gravitational encounters are considered. This investigation is focused on the aggregation of massive bodies in the outer planetary region and on the consequences of such process in the corresponding cometary belt. We study the link between the bombardment of massive bodies and mass depletion and eccentricity excitation.
